Use to come here as a kid, used to live not far from here, love coming back each trip to see how many new coins have been hammered into the 2 money stumps using the local rocks. The fairy steps bring back so many memories, apparently if you make a wish at the bottom, then climb the fairy steps without touching the sides then your wish will come true and you'll meet a fairy. What a fantastic place to visit full of history and folklore , we parked in Beetham opposite the church and then asked a very helpful local the best way to go and following his instructions had a lovely circular walk upto the fairy steps and back round to the village, tried to walk down and back up without touching the sides which was fun and impossible, the scenery of the surrounding area was stunning and I would highly recommend a visit to the fairy steps if you are in the area.
Lovely family friendly wood walk. Suitable for toddlers. Not ok for pushchairs. Lots of blackberries on the side of the track, yum yum. Difficult to find a parking spot in the village. There is a parking lot but belongs to a hotel and costs 10£
